## Configuration

Fixturefox generates deterministic test data from declared schemas. Plugins register custom generators through the `fixturefox.providers` entry point and inherit the global seed unless they override it. Remote schema fetching is disabled by default; enable it with `FIXTUREFOX_REMOTE=1`. Plugins that pull schemas from a private registry must authenticate, so add the following line to your `.env` file:

secret setting of bajeg-yahog: LEDGER_TOKEN20=f833f3e2e6625ec0dee3

## Configuration — Undo/Redo in SketchLoom

SketchLoom's diagram editor keeps an undo stack per session, capped by UNDO_DEPTH (default 100). Redo history is cleared on any new edit, which is expected behavior, not a bug. On-call engineers should check UNDO_PERSIST=true before restarting, since session snapshots sync to the Histo store. That sync is authenticated, and the store's access secret is set on the following line of the env file.

vault entry, yahaf-tagug: LEDGER_TOKEN20=884d77d1a8b98aa4edfb

**Q: Are the lifts running this weekend?**

Heads up, contractors: the lifts at Marlow Court get their quarterly service every second weekend of the month, usually Saturday morning through Sunday noon. During that window you'll need the stairwell on the east side — it's the grey door past the loading bay. Sign in at the hutch as usual, and bring your kit up in stages if it's heavy. To get through the stairwell door, use the access code below.

staff pass of kawip-hawef = bdg-QLP-2

Ticket TRN-812: turnstile counter misconfigured at Halvern Stadium east gate.

Counts stopped syncing after last night's deploy. Root cause: the staging env file was copied to prod, so the GateSync agent points at the wrong broker. Fix: set `GATESYNC_BROKER_HOST` to the prod broker and restart the agent. The agent also needs its prod auth token, which goes on the line immediately after this one.

vault entry, yahif-yajep: COURIER_KEY29=b802bdf8034096b65a51c6ba5abe2